Hands by A lbrecht Durer, the s o - c a lle d ` p erfect artist' --w hose woodcut and copper engravings were major e x p r e s s i o n s of h is art. He u s e d many religio u s themes, and was noted for his sen sitiv e and detailed drawings. The story is that these were the hands o f som eone who had great faith in his ability, and worked to help him attain his artistic training; that in the p rocess, their own hands becam e so gnarled as to be incap ab le o f equal work; and in gratitude, and because he saw their labor of love as beautiful, he immortalized the hands.
